Default IS250 VS IS350 offsets

Will some wheels fits into a IS250 and NOT fit into IS350?? Is the offsets different for both car? As the IS350 has bigger brakes and rotors.

The offests remain the same.

Like llamaboiz says, the front wheel disc type has to be a HIGH DISK for an IS350 to bolt right on. A MID DISC can be used on an IS350 to gain more lip size, but a spacer needs to be run behind the wheel, and then the offset adjusted accordingly, which will usually removes the lip size anyway.


The 250/350 both use the same LOW DISC in the rear.


It appears the popular offset types for ISX50's are (based on 8.5 front, 9.5 rear):

Mild: +42 to +45 front and rear

More agressive: +38 front, +40 rear

"Matching" more agressive: +36 front and rear

Agressive with fender liner work : +30 front, +35 rear

Very agressive with fender work: +28 front, +32 rear

VIP style with major fender work: +21 front, +25/27 rear
